Abstract

Numerical simulations of two heavy rain cases in the Changjiang-Huaihe river basin have been carried out with TRMM/PR (Tropical Rainfall Measuring Mission/Precipitation Radar) data incorporating into the PSU/NCAR meso-scale model MM5.First, rainwater mixing ratio qr is obtained from different Z-qr relations variating with height.Then, while specific humidity q'v in the model is replace with qv, where q'v=qv+qr.Based on the above idea, TRMM/PR data is used to modify humidity obtained by conventional radiosound data.Simulation are performed and compared with the control run.The results show that both the heavy rainfall distribution and its heavy rain core amounts in sensitivity run are better than in control one.
